nemesis
nem|esis /n'emɪsɪs/
[N-UNCOUNT] oft with poss
The nemesis of a person or thing is a situation, event, or person which causes them to be seriously harmed, especially as a punishment.
Yet the imminent crisis in its balance of payments may be the President's nemesis.
